My Trane heat pump's compressor would fail to start... Called HVAC service and they installed a Chinese made $10 jump start capacitor booster to get it up and running. Service call+diagnosis+JUNK booster was over $300 and it still took 15-20 cycles before the compressor would eventually kick on. I bought this to replace the OEM start capacitor that had gone bad and now the system is working perfectly again. I pulled that junk booster off the run capacitor and have saved it for when/if I have another issue. Bottom line, 90% of HVAC calls on outdoor units that cost $100's of dollars involve just replacing the run capacitor that costs about $10-$15 or the start capacitor that costs about $40-$70. Note: The start capacitor usually has quite a long life and mine finally failed after 14 years. It is usually the smaller and cheaper run capacitor that fails first. If you are DIY'er keep one of each on hand as cheap insurance compared to calling HVAC service. If your outdoor unit kicks on and only the fan comes on while the compressor tries to start over and over and over again THAT IS A BAD CAPICITOR and 90% of the time you can fix the problem yourself if you have replacements on hand.
